⬤ Nvidia's CUDA platform keeps getting stronger as the backbone of generative AI and high-performance computing. What started as a simple GPU programming framework has grown into a full ecosystem that powers everything from university research labs to massive cloud data centers. The platform's reach across the AI industry shows just how much Nvidia has invested in making developers' lives easier.
⬤ At its core, CUDA is Nvidia's proprietary system for squeezing maximum performance out of GPUs. Over the years, the company has added features like Unified Memory, which made it simpler for developers to move data between CPUs and GPUs without writing tons of extra code. For deep learning work specifically, tools like cuDNN and NCCL have become essential for training large neural networks efficiently and scaling them across multiple GPUs.
CUDA has steadily expanded its capabilities to address critical operational challenges faced by hyperscale customers running large-scale AI workloads.
⬤ Competition is heating up from AMD's ROCm platform and Google's TPUs, but Nvidia isn't just relying on faster chips to stay ahead. The CUDA 13.1 release brought some practical improvements that matter for real-world AI work. CUDA Tile and Tile IR are designed to make it easier for developers to write high-performance code and run it across different systems without rewriting everything from scratch. These aren't flashy features, but they solve headaches that hyperscale customers deal with when running massive AI workloads.
⬤ What's interesting about Nvidia's approach is how much they're focusing on software, not just hardware. By constantly improving their libraries, developer tools, and abstractions, they're making CUDA harder to walk away from. For companies building AI infrastructure, switching platforms means rewriting code and retraining teams—that's a big barrier. As generative AI keeps scaling up globally, CUDA's role as the foundation layer only gets more important to Nvidia's long-term position in the market.
Saad Ullah
Saad Ullah